Step 1: The computer/display.
This was probably the easiest. Everything fit and worked right away.
Raspberry Pi 3 B+
Official Raspberry Pi 7" touch screen
SmartPi Touch Pro case
Anker PowerCore Slim 10000 battery

Step 2: The Keyboard
This proved to be the hardest part so far.
Clawsome Boards "The Coupe" 60% board

[photos] My first build (no case yet, for a cyberdeck)

Finished Keyboard
I accidentally joined connections on the ProMicro microcontroller and couldn't desolder it enough to fix. I had to cut the bastard out.

Kailh purple switches
Clawsome board
YMDK Carbon caps
Bit-C microcontroller because I fried the ProMicro.

Step 3: USB keyboard Cable
I decided to do this on a whim. It is not perfect but it works and it was really satisfying.

Current Progress
I mostly need to make something to bind it all together and hold the power pack. I'm contemplating working in a trackball or tiny joystick to act as a mouse, although with the touch screen it's not necessary.
